Contents
- 📊 Introduction to Information Extraction
- 🤖 The Role of Natural Language Processing in IE
- 📄 Extracting Insights from Unstructured Data
- 📊 The Power of Data Insight: Applications and Use Cases
- 📈 The Future of Information Extraction: Trends and Challenges
- 📊 Information Extraction Techniques: A Deep Dive
- 📊 Named Entity Recognition: A Key Component of IE
- 📊 Relationship Extraction: Uncovering Hidden Connections
- 📊 Event Extraction: Identifying and Analyzing Events
- 📊 Information Extraction Evaluation Metrics: Measuring Success
- 📊 Real-World Applications of Information Extraction
- 📊 The Intersection of Information Extraction and [[artificial-intelligence|Artificial Intelligence]]
- Frequently Asked Questions
- Related Topics
Overview
Information extraction, a subset of natural language processing, has its roots in the early days of computing, with the first experiments in machine translation and text analysis dating back to the 1950s. The field has evolved significantly, with the advent of machine learning algorithms and big data analytics. Today, information extraction is a crucial component of various applications, including sentiment analysis, entity recognition, and topic modeling. The technology has been influenced by key figures such as Yann LeCun and Fei-Fei Li, who have contributed to the development of convolutional neural networks and large-scale image recognition systems. With a vibe score of 8, indicating a high level of cultural energy, information extraction continues to shape industries such as finance, healthcare, and marketing. As the field advances, it is expected to have a significant impact on decision-making processes, with potential applications in predictive analytics and recommender systems, raising questions about data privacy and the ethics of AI-driven insight generation.
📊 Introduction to Information Extraction
Information extraction (IE) is a crucial task in the field of Artificial Intelligence that involves automatically extracting structured information from unstructured and/or semi-structured machine-readable documents and other electronically represented sources. This process typically involves Natural Language Processing (NLP) to analyze human language texts. Recent advancements in Multimedia Document Processing have expanded the scope of IE to include automatic annotation and content extraction from images, audio, video, and documents. For instance, Google Cloud Vision uses IE to extract insights from visual data. As a result, IE has become a vital component of various applications, including Text Analysis and Data Mining.
🤖 The Role of Natural Language Processing in IE
The role of NLP in IE is multifaceted. NLP techniques, such as Tokenization and Part-of-Speech Tagging, are used to analyze human language texts and extract relevant information. Furthermore, Named Entity Recognition (NER) and Relationship Extraction are essential components of IE that rely heavily on NLP. The integration of NLP and IE has enabled the development of more sophisticated Information Retrieval Systems. Companies like IBM and Microsoft are leveraging NLP and IE to improve their Customer Service Chatbots.
📄 Extracting Insights from Unstructured Data
Extracting insights from unstructured data is a significant challenge in IE. Unstructured data, such as text documents, images, and audio files, lacks a predefined format, making it difficult to analyze and extract relevant information. However, advancements in Machine Learning and Deep Learning have enabled the development of more effective IE techniques. For example, Convolutional Neural Networks (CNNs) can be used to extract features from images, while RNNs can be used to analyze sequential data, such as text or audio. Additionally, Transfer Learning has improved the performance of IE models on NLP tasks. Researchers are also exploring the application of Explainable AI to improve the transparency of IE models.
📊 The Power of Data Insight: Applications and Use Cases
The power of data insight is a significant driver of the adoption of IE in various industries. By extracting relevant information from large datasets, organizations can gain valuable insights that inform business decisions, improve operational efficiency, and enhance customer experience. For instance, Customer Relationship Management (CRM) systems rely heavily on IE to extract customer data and preferences. Moreover, Supply Chain Management systems use IE to analyze logistics and shipping data. The use of IE in Healthcare has also improved patient outcomes by enabling the extraction of insights from medical records and images. As the amount of available data continues to grow, the demand for effective IE techniques will increase, driving innovation in the field of Data Science.
📈 The Future of Information Extraction: Trends and Challenges
The future of IE is exciting, with several trends and challenges on the horizon. One of the significant trends is the increasing use of Cloud Computing and Edge Computing to support IE applications. Additionally, the integration of IoT devices and IE will enable the extraction of insights from real-time data streams. However, the increasing complexity of data and the need for more sophisticated IE techniques will also pose significant challenges. For example, Adversarial Attacks on IE models can compromise their accuracy and reliability. To address these challenges, researchers are exploring the development of more robust IE models using Adversarial Training and Ensemble Methods.
📊 Information Extraction Techniques: A Deep Dive
IE techniques can be broadly categorized into two types: Rule-Based Systems and Machine Learning-Based Systems. Rule-Based Systems rely on predefined rules to extract information, while Machine Learning-Based Systems use statistical models to learn patterns in the data. Supervised Learning and Unsupervised Learning are two popular machine learning approaches used in IE. Furthermore, Semi-Supervised Learning and Reinforcement Learning are also being explored for IE tasks. The choice of IE technique depends on the specific application, data characteristics, and performance requirements. For instance, Named Entity Recognition (NER) is a popular IE technique used in Text Analysis applications.
📊 Named Entity Recognition: A Key Component of IE
Named Entity Recognition (NER) is a fundamental component of IE that involves identifying and categorizing named entities in unstructured text into predefined categories. NER is a crucial step in Information Retrieval Systems and Question Answering Systems. The performance of NER systems is typically evaluated using metrics such as Precision, Recall, and F1-Score. Recent advancements in Deep Learning have improved the accuracy of NER systems, enabling their application in various domains, including Healthcare and Finance. For example, Stanford CoreNLP is a popular NER tool used in NLP applications.
📊 Event Extraction: Identifying and Analyzing Events
Event Extraction is a type of IE that involves identifying and extracting events from unstructured text. Event Extraction is a critical component of Event-Driven Systems and Decision Support Systems. The performance of Event Extraction systems is typically evaluated using metrics such as Precision, Recall, and F1-Score. Recent advancements in Sequence Labeling have improved the accuracy of Event Extraction systems, enabling their application in various domains, including Finance and Politics. For instance, Event Extraction is used in News Article Analysis to identify and extract events from news articles.
📊 Information Extraction Evaluation Metrics: Measuring Success
Evaluating the performance of IE systems is crucial to ensure their accuracy and reliability. Common evaluation metrics used in IE include Precision, Recall, and F1-Score. Additionally, Mean Average Precision (MAP) and MRR are used to evaluate the ranking quality of IE systems. The choice of evaluation metric depends on the specific IE task and application. For example, Named Entity Recognition (NER) systems are typically evaluated using Precision, Recall, and F1-Score.
📊 Real-World Applications of Information Extraction
IE has numerous real-world applications across various industries, including Healthcare, Finance, and Customer Service. In Healthcare, IE is used to extract insights from medical records and images, improving patient outcomes and streamlining clinical workflows. In Finance, IE is used to analyze financial news and reports, enabling investors to make informed decisions. In Customer Service, IE is used to extract customer feedback and preferences, improving customer experience and loyalty. For instance, Chatbots use IE to extract insights from customer interactions and provide personalized responses.
📊 The Intersection of Information Extraction and [[artificial-intelligence|Artificial Intelligence]]
The intersection of IE and Artificial Intelligence is a rapidly evolving field, with significant potential for innovation and growth. The integration of IE and Machine Learning has enabled the development of more sophisticated IE systems, capable of extracting insights from large datasets. Furthermore, the use of Deep Learning techniques, such as CNNs and RNNs, has improved the accuracy and efficiency of IE systems. As the field of Artificial Intelligence continues to evolve, the importance of IE will only continue to grow, driving innovation and advancement in various industries and applications.
Key Facts
- Year
- 1950
- Origin
- Machine Translation and Text Analysis Research
- Category
- Artificial Intelligence
- Type
- Concept
Frequently Asked Questions
What is Information Extraction?
Information Extraction (IE) is the task of automatically extracting structured information from unstructured and/or semi-structured machine-readable documents and other electronically represented sources. IE involves using various techniques, such as Natural Language Processing (NLP), to analyze human language texts and extract relevant information. The goal of IE is to enable the extraction of insights from large datasets, improving decision-making and operational efficiency in various industries.
What are the applications of Information Extraction?
IE has numerous real-world applications across various industries, including Healthcare, Finance, and Customer Service. In Healthcare, IE is used to extract insights from medical records and images, improving patient outcomes and streamlining clinical workflows. In Finance, IE is used to analyze financial news and reports, enabling investors to make informed decisions. In Customer Service, IE is used to extract customer feedback and preferences, improving customer experience and loyalty.
What is Named Entity Recognition?
Named Entity Recognition (NER) is a fundamental component of IE that involves identifying and categorizing named entities in unstructured text into predefined categories. NER is a crucial step in Information Retrieval Systems and Question Answering Systems. The performance of NER systems is typically evaluated using metrics such as Precision, Recall, and F1-Score.
What is Relationship Extraction?
Relationship Extraction is a type of IE that involves identifying and extracting relationships between entities in unstructured text. Relationship Extraction is a critical component of Knowledge Graph Construction and Question Answering Systems. The performance of Relationship Extraction systems is typically evaluated using metrics such as Precision, Recall, and F1-Score.
What is Event Extraction?
Event Extraction is a type of IE that involves identifying and extracting events from unstructured text. Event Extraction is a critical component of Event-Driven Systems and Decision Support Systems. The performance of Event Extraction systems is typically evaluated using metrics such as Precision, Recall, and F1-Score.
How is Information Extraction evaluated?
Evaluating the performance of IE systems is crucial to ensure their accuracy and reliability. Common evaluation metrics used in IE include Precision, Recall, and F1-Score. Additionally, Mean Average Precision (MAP) and MRR are used to evaluate the ranking quality of IE systems. The choice of evaluation metric depends on the specific IE task and application.
What is the future of Information Extraction?
The future of IE is exciting, with several trends and challenges on the horizon. One of the significant trends is the increasing use of Cloud Computing and Edge Computing to support IE applications. Additionally, the integration of IoT devices and IE will enable the extraction of insights from real-time data streams. However, the increasing complexity of data and the need for more sophisticated IE techniques will also pose significant challenges.